Description
We are a couple living in the norwegian countryside. Silent and peaceful. We live with 6 fantastic animals - 3 dogs (Zuna, Lila, Jaško), 1 bunny (Dagmar), 1 cat (Aurora) and 1 pig (Champis).

Cultural exchange and learning opportunities
Place is situated 40 km from Oslo. So you can explore the capital city of Norway.
Place itself is surrounded by huge silent forests, nearby is Solbergfossen (waterfall), tens of lakes. Its very suitable for people who love peace and quiet.
Help
We need a person/couple who would love to take care of animals while we are partly or fully away. Feeding and walking the dogs.

Accommodation
You will have your own bedroom upstairs (2 bedrooms available).
Camping available.
Food costs covered.
What else ...
In your free time you could either taste a city life (Oslo, Drammen) or get lost in endless deep forests with the dogs.
Bus connection is not the best, but possible. Its an advantage to have a driving license.
